There is a known issue that will affect a small number of users, including those with Hungarian regional options, where the installer fails to start after prepartion of the InstallAware Wizard. To remedy this issue, open the Regional and Language Options in Control Panel and temporarily switch your Regional Options setting to English. After install, you can safely restore your regional setting. Extract the.zip file into an empty directory on your hard drive.

Installing and Using Purchased Network Licenses. If you purchased Networked Licenses (managed by the Embarcadero License Server or FLEX) for Delphi 2010 or CBuilder 2010, you must follow these instructions to set up the install image or your users will be prompted for a serial number and be unable to install. If you have a media kit:. Copy all of the DVD files to a writeable directory on your network. Copy the networked license.slip file (received in your order confirmation email) to the directory where Setup.exe is located.
When your users run Setup.exe, the product detects the.slip file and installs the software. During installation, the.slip file is moved to the license folder in the installation directory.
If you have an electronic software download:. Copy over just the setup.exe and slip file into the same directory. Run setup and the install will read the slip to determine which sku you have purchased.

During the installation of prerequisites, the Installer does not notify you if you have less than the required free space. If you try to install with too little space, the install hangs. See Minimum System Requirements for exact specification. The Database Pack and/or C Boost Libraries will not install on Vista if you do not accept the escalation request during the install process.
After an install, you should have the following entries under Add/Remove Programs: Embarcadero RAD Studio 2010, Embarcadero Delphi and CBuilder 2010 Database Pack, and Boost Libraries for CBuilder 2010 (if CBuilder was installed). If any of these are missing, open a command-line window, go to where your install files are located, and run: dbpacksetup.exe boostsetup.exe (for CBuilder 2010 users only) Uninstalling This Product. To uninstall the product, the Administrator who initially installed the product must open the Control Panel, select Add or Remove Programs, select Embarcadero RAD Studio and click the Remove button. After uninstalling, in order to remove user-specific data from the Windows registry, all non-Administrator users of the product must log in and delete the following registry key: HKEYCURRENTUSER Software Embarcadero BDS 7.0 WARNING: Registry editing is performed at your own risk. In Add/Remove Programs, there will be entries for Embarcadero RAD Studio 2010, Embarcadero Delphi and CBuilder 2010 Help System, Embarcadero Delphi and CBuilder 2010 Database Pack, and Boost Libraries for CBuilder 2010. When you select the RAD Studio entry to uninstall, the Database Pack and Boost will also get uninstalled.
You will need to remove the Help separately. The Database Pack is required by the IDE. You should not uninstall the Database Pack separately. After uninstalling, user-specific data such as default project settings might remain in configuration files found in this directory:. Documents and Settings Application Data Embarcadero BDS 7.0.
This folder should be manually removed. Do You Have an Installation Problem?

When I try to open trunk lib Indy.Sockets.bdsproj I get message; 'The project can not be loaded because the required personality DelphiDotNet.personality is not available' What am I missing? You are opening the wrong file. That project is meant for Delphi.NET. You need to compile IndySystem###.dpk, IndyCore###.dpk, IndyProtocols###.dpk.dpk, dclIndyCore###.dpk, and dclIndyProtocols###.dpk packages individually instead (where ### is 120 or 130, I forget which one works correctly in D2009).
